Other lax scores 5/12-5/13

Posted by Jacob '06 
Other lax scores 5/12-5/13
Posted by: Jacob '06 (---.dhcp.psdn.ca.charter.com)
Date: May 12, 2007 01:31PM

Duke 18 - Providence 3 Final
Hopkins 11- Notre Dame 10 Final (OT)
Georgetown 9 - Princeton 8 Final (OT)
Albany 19 - Loyola(MD) 10 Final
Delaware 14 - Virginia 8 Final
North Carolina 12 - Navy 8 Final
UMBC 13 - Maryland 9 Final

2nd round matchups are:
Duke vs. UNC
Cornell vs. Albany
JHU vs. Georgetown
Delaware vs. UMBC
